Jump to content

Rasel

Newbie
  • Posts

    19
  • Joined

  • Last visited

Everything posted by Rasel

  1. Спасибо за ответы! Whatsup Шрифты лучше указывать в em ?
  2. Ребят пожалуйста объясните почему при масштабирование, а именно когда мы уменьшаем в google chrome масштаб съезжают буквы... Не могу понять почему и как с этим бороться. http://rasel.on.ufanet.ru/ - вот к примеру меню. При масштабировании буквы съезжают и это только в google chrome HTML <!DOCTYPE html> <html> <head> <title></title> <link href="source/style/style.css" type='text/css' rel='StyleSheet' /> <meta http-equiv="content-type" content="text/html; charset=windows-1251" /> </head> <body> <div class="menu"> <ul> <li><a href="#">ГЛАВНАЯ</a></li> <li><a href="#">О КОМПАНИИ</a></li> <li><a href="#">КАТАЛОГ</a></li> <li><a href="#">СОПУТСТВУЮЩИЕ ТОВАРЫ</a></li> <li><a href="#">НОВОСТИ</a></li> <li><a href="#">АКЦИИ</a></li> <li><a href="#">ДИЛЕРЫ</a></li> <li><a href="#">ОБРАТНАЯ СВЯЗЬ</a></li> <li><a href="#">КОНТАКТЫ</a></li> </ul> </div><!--.menu--> </body> </html> CSS /* CSS Document */ /* All CSS */ body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,code,form,fieldset,legend,input,button,textarea,p,blockquote,th,td { margin:0; padding:0; } a img { border: none; } .clear { clear: both; } .menu { width: 1000px; margin: 38px 0 0 0; height: 39px; overflow: hidden; background: url('images/menu_fon.png') no-repeat center top; } div.menu ul { list-style: none; text-align: center; font-size: 0px; } div.menu ul li { text-align: center; display: inline-block; *zoom : 1; background: url('images/line_menu.png') no-repeat right 6px; } div.menu ul li:last-child { background: none; } div.menu ul li a { display: block; font-family: verdana, arial; padding: 0 12px; height: 36px; max-height: 36px; margin: 2px 0 0 0; text-decoration: none; font-weight: bold; line-height: 36px; color: #ffffff; font-size: 11px; } div.menu ul li a:hover { background: #cb4cba; }
  3. Спасибо. ребят уже сам разобрался, немного по своему сделал, но все работает
  4. походу никто не поможет
  5. Всем доброго вечера. Ребят столкнулся с такой проблемой, возможно она примитивна, но все же хочу узнать совета знающих людей. имеется меню тип список ul. Наглядный макет HTML код. <ul> <li> <div class="image_menu"><img src="путь" /></div> <div class="link_menu"><a href="#">Link</a></div> </li> <li> <div class="image_menu"><img src="путь" /></div> <div class="link_menu"><a href="#">Link</a></div> </li> <li> <div class="image_menu"><img src="путь" /></div> <div class="link_menu"><a href="#">Link</a></div> </li> </ul> css код div.image_menu { width:40px; height:40px; float:left; } div.link_menu { width:150px; height:40px; float:right; margin:10px 0 0 0; } Вопрос в следующем. Как отменить обтекания, после <div class="link_menu"><a href="#">Link</a></div> Знаю один способ дописать <li> <div class="image_menu"><img src="путь" /></div> <div class="link_menu"><a href="#">Link</a></div> <div style="clear:both;"></div> </li> Есть другие варианты, так как мне данный способ не нравится. Пробовал display:inline, тоже не вариант. Если подобная тема была уже создана, то пожалуйста простите, так как в поиске не нашел, в гугле тоже )
  6. Temiks Softlink Спасиб ) Сегодня сделал Сделал по своему но принцип работы такой же как в ваших советы )
  7. Ребят спасибо вам за советы. Завтра попробую ваши способы, надеюсь помогут Напишу результаты )
  8. Temiks Спасибо за совет. То есть сделать див по середине в блоке header или в блоке content туда засунуть меню и с помошью position сместить, я правильно понял ? А что за способ, который намного лучше ? На ноуте все файлы,а он на работе А перекачать забыл, так бы сразу все скинул. Макет там почти такой же за исключением некоторых деталей, но они не существенные.
  9. В данный момент код такой. html <div id="main_top_menu"> <div id="top_menu"> <ul> <li><a href="about.html">О компании</a></li> <li><a href="faq.html">Как заказать</a></li> <li><a href="portfolio.html">Наши работы</a></li> <li><a href="#">Цены</a></li> <li><a href="#">Печать на шарах</a></li> <li><a href="#">Контакты</a></li> </ul> </div> </div> css div#main_top_menu { width:100%; position: relative; top: 80px; border: solid 1px #FF0000; /*удалить*/ } div#top_menu { width: 1000px; margin: 0 auto; height: 70px; background: url(images/system/top_menu.png) no-repeat; border: solid 1px #000000; /*удалить*/ } div#top_menu ul { height: 60px; list-style-type: none; } div#top_menu ul li { float: left; margin: 4px 0 0 0; height: 50px; } ну и так далее... Смысл в том что само меню (<div id="top_menu">) с фоном лежит в блоке main_top_menu, который имеет ширину 100%. Меню по центру и имеет ширину 1000px. Я пробовал сегодня много вариантов, в данный момент на этом остановился. Вот блин зациклился на этой проблеме и все... (
  10. Ребят пожалуйста помогите. Вот честно юзал поиск, но не нашел подобной темы. Интересует мнение опытных верстальщиков. Ситуация следующая http://linkme.ufanet.ru/images/2e5e9e0e12db0195fe7d601beb4aa5bf.jpg набросал макет. Имеется три блока <div>. 1-header 2-menu 3-content в 1 все понятно. Логотип, телефон и т.п. Ширина фиксированная допустим 1000px margin:0 auto; 2-меню ! Блок шириной 100% Вот тут то моя проблема. Ломаю голову целый день не могу найти красивого решения проблемы, и некрасивого не нашел. Возможно все делается просто, но я не могу найти выход... Вроде и опыта не мало, но как коса на камень... Что тут требуется, а нужно сделать след. на картинке изображено меню, оно должно распологаться точно так же как на макете, но с левой стороны должен быть фон(только с левой) что бы на разных разрешениях оно растягивалось от левого края, другими словами меню должно быть резиновое, но фон должен быть только с левой стороны. с блоком контент все тоже понятно 1000px margin:0 auto; Ссылку не могу кинуть, так как сайт на localhost. Макет там точно такой же как на картинке. возможно надо реализовать конструкцию блок в блоке и т.п. Помогите пожалуйста...
  11. Нет я не хотел использовать модные технологии. Я лишь хотел узнать как использовать блоки <div> и как делают опытные верстальщики. Способ который вы показали на мой взгляд яв-ся самый удобным и лучшим. PIE.htc суда по вашим комментам яв-ся ненадежным.
  12. Благодарю, теперь у меня все вопросы отпали )
  13. Css код. body { background-color:#000000; } div.top { background:url(images/top.jpg) no-repeat; width:200px; height:20px; margin:0px; padding:0px; } div.center { background:url(images/center.jpg) repeat-y; width:200px; margin:0px; padding:0px; } div.bottom { background:url(images/bottom.jpg) no-repeat; width:200px; height:20px; margin:0px; padding:0px; } HTML код <div class="top"></div> <div class="center"> <p>Здесь находится контент !</p> <p>Здесь находится контент !</p> <p>Здесь находится контент !</p> <p>Здесь находится контент !</p> </div> <div class="bottom"></div> Вот про эти разрывы я говорил. Возможно я css делаю не правильно ) РЕЗУЛЬТАТ )
  14. Немного почитал, очень заинтрегован, не слышал об этом PIE. кросбраузерность от ie6 (будь прокляты все IE)
  15. Ширина была фиксированная. Высота резиновая. Сейчас поищу пример и скину, 1 минуту.
  16. Нужно именно что бы тень оставалась, которая на макете(правда она тут плоховато получилась), так как это важный элемент дизайна, а не просто закруглить углы.
  17. Согласен ! Собственно именно из-за этого написал. Пробовал, или я что то не так делал, у меня при вставке тега <p> появлялись разрывы в фоне. Но скажу честно, не стал заморачиваться, решил сделать по старинке в таблицах, так как нужно было срочно доделать работу. если можно то пожалуйста небольшой пример скиньте.
  18. Гуру верстки, подскажите, каким способом лучше реализовать блок контента с закругленными углами. - Пример макета. Лично я всегда использую таблицы. Я разбиваю изображение на 3 части. Далее создаю таблицу из 3 строк и 1 столбца. В верхнюю строку сую фоном top (высоту и ширину фиксирую). В среднею фоном center (сюда в дальнейшем помещаю контент ). И в последнею самую нижнею bottom (высоту и ширину фиксирую). Подскажите яв-ся ли мой способ правильным ? Хотелось бы услышать как это реализовать с помощью дивов. Простите если пложу темы в поиск не отправляйте, так как прочитал уже много информации на данную проблему. Мне охото услышать мнение знающих людей.
×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ue. See more about our Guidelines and Privacy Policy